| Summary: | Заглавие с экрана The results of first-principle calculations of valence electron distribution in the titanium-hydrogen system with vacancy have been presented. The formation of the hydrogen-vacancy subsystems in the Ti-H leads to strongly anisotropic redistribution of the metal charge density. It is shown that the location of hydrogen in the interstitial near the vacancy is characterized by strong chemical binding of hydrogen with titanium. |
